Description

A feeding tube is a medical device used to provide nutrition to patients who cannot eat or swallow normally. It delivers food, fluids, and medications directly into the stomach or intestines.

Primary Medical Uses:
– Nutritional support for patients with difficulty swallowing or eating due to conditions such as stroke, cancer, neurological disorders, or surgery.
– Temporary or long-term feeding assistance.

Drug Class or Type:
– Medical feeding device (not a drug).

General Mechanism of Action:
– The tube bypasses the mouth and throat to deliver nutrients directly into the digestive tract, ensuring the patient receives adequate nutrition.

Common Forms:
– Nasogastric (NG) tube: inserted through the nose into the stomach.
– Gastrostomy tube (G-tube): surgically placed directly into the stomach.
– Jejunostomy tube (J-tube): placed into the small intestine for feeding.

Dosage Instructions:
– Feeding volumes and schedules are prescribed by healthcare providers based on individual nutritional needs.
– Administration can be continuous or intermittent.

Side Effects, Contraindications, or Interactions:
– Possible complications include infection, tube displacement, clogging, aspiration, or irritation at the insertion site.
– Contraindications depend on patient condition and type of feeding tube.
– Requires proper care and monitoring by healthcare professionals.

Feeding tubes are critical for patients who need assisted nutrition and should be managed under medical supervision.
